Kian Soltani - Dvorak: Cello Concerto (CD)
Two years after his successful Deutsche Grammophon Debut Album "Home" Kian Soltani returns with a Dvorak Album featuring the famous cello concerto and five arrangements of some of the greatest pieces Antonin Dvorak composed. Dvorak's Cello Concerto op. 104 hasn't been recorded for the yellow label since 2002 (Mischa Maisky with Mehta and Berliner Philharmoniker).
Maestro Daniel Barenboim and the Staatskapelle Berlin accompany Kian Soltani in the concerto, while for the other pieces (three of which have been arranged by Kian Soltani himself) he is joined by six cellists of the Staatskapelle Berlin.
